How much does it cost to rent an apartment in East Lynne?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
East Lynne Studio Apartments | $1,103 | $675 | $1,910 |
East Lynne 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,533 | $715 | $4,886 |
East Lynne 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,780 | $875 | $7,138 |
East Lynne 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,903 | $1,000 | $6,761 |
East Lynne 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,281 | $1,500 | $2,695 |

What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
